PXC 5.7 fails during SST when started with keyring_vault server

Description

Following test was performed to check if PXC 5.7 can work with Keyring vault plugin.

 

Below error is seen in the logs:

 

 

 

If same steps are performed on PXC-8.0, there are no errors.

Also, if we use keyring_plugin instead there are no failures on both PXC-5.7 and PXC-8.0

 

A line by line comparison of logs was done when node 2 is started with keyring_file plugin and keyring_vault plugin.

Logs:
node2 logs keyring_file (success): https://gist.github.com/mohitj1988/a5cfe7b4d9478f0c2667efb0c1266a49

node 2 logs keyring_vault(failure):
https://gist.github.com/mohitj1988/236a0d78609992e7bc9a0048713c259e

innobackup.prepare.log: https://gist.github.com/mohitj1988/80da4841610933179a2184fa432a814a

 

I have also attached 2 scripts to repeat the issue.

Script 1: Perform tests on PXC-8.0 using keyring_vault plugin (Success)
Script 2: Perform tests on PXC-5.7 using keyring_vault plugin (Failure)

How to run the script:

 

Environment

None

Attachments

2

Smart Checklist

Activity

Details

Assignee

Reporter

Needs QA

Yes

Affects versions

Priority

Smart Checklist

Created September 23, 2022 at 7:43 AM
Updated March 6, 2024 at 8:50 PM